Starting Saturday Nov. 14, 2020, Niagara Region is imposing new restrictions for wineries and similar establishments. These new restrictions allow us to stay open for tasting in a modified, although restructured and reduced way. To comply with this new regulations, we are required to take full contact tracing for all guests entering the building for anything longer than a “brief” (shopping) visit. We are also require that guests can only sit at the same table with members from their direct household. These changes have caused us to reduce our seating capacity slightly to help accomodate these changes and to ensure everyones continued safety.
With increased times to check everyone in and out, we anticipate there being a slightly longer wait time to get a seat for tasting. At this time, we are continuing to maintain all our other covid safety measures.
